Coweta County Kindergarten registration May 4 - 29
 

Early enrollment for 2009-10 school year Kindergarten will be held between May 4 and May 29, at the school system’s Central Registration Center.

May Registration for 2009-10 Kindergarten classes will be held on different weeks at the Central Registration Center, depending on which elementary school a child will attend (check the calendar below for details).

Pre-K enrollment will be held earlier at the registration center, in April, following in-school registration in March and the March 20 lottery drawing for Pre-K spots.

New student registration is held at the Central Registration Center at 167 Werz Boulevard in Newnan (call 770-254-5551 for more details, or visit www.cowetaschools.org/registration.).

Children must be four years old before September 1, 2009 to be eligible for next year’s Pre-K, and must be five years old before September 1 to enroll in Kindergarten.

Children who are enrolled this year in a Coweta County public school Pre-Kindergarten class do not need to re-enroll for Kindergarten.

The following items are required to enroll a new student:

1. Birth Certificate – State-issued, certified copy (hospital certificate not accepted).
2. Social Security Card
3. Proof of Residence – two items from the following list are required for address verification:

a. property tax records which indicate the location of the residence;
b. mortgage documents or a security deed which indicates the location of the residence;
c. apartment or home lease or rent receipt indicating the current address;
d. current electrical bill or application for electrical service showing the current address (please bring the entire bill, to show electrical service and address);
e. voter precinct identification card or other voter documentation indicating the current address.

4. State ID or Drivers License – Must be current (not expired). Students may only be registered by biological parent(s) or legal guardian(s). Proof of custody/guardianship is required if registering adult is not the birth parent.
5. Custody papers (if relevant) - If parents are divorced they must provide a copy of custody papers. Legal guardian(s) will also have to provide a copy of custody papers. Custodial parent(s)/guardian(s) must live in the appropriate school district.
6. Last Report Card/Withdrawal/Transfer Form with Grades – (not applicable for newly-enrolled Pre-Kindergarten or Kindergarten students)
7. Immunization Certificate – Georgia Department of Human Resources (DHR) immunization certificate form 3231 or a signed 30-day waiver.
8. Hearing-Dental-Vision Certificate on Georgia Form 3300 or a signed 120-day waiver.
9. Authorization for release of IEP or records – If a student is receiving Special Education or Gifted services.
10. Emergency contact information – Students must have a contact on file by the first day of school.
The first eight of the above requirements must be presented at the time of registration.
